Crypto Sponsorships Banned by UK Regulator

FCA Cautions Premier League Clubs on Unlicensed Crypto Partnerships

  • The UK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) warned Premier League clubs against partnering with unauthorized cryptocurrency companies.
  • Clubs risk legal repercussions if they engage with crypto firms not licensed in the UK.
  • Lucy Castledine from the FCA expressed concerns over misleading fans and potential criminal activities linked to such sponsorships.
  • Exchanges BingX and OKX, which have deals with major clubs, are not listed as FCA-authorized entities.
  • The FCA communicated directly with clubs considered at risk due to these partnerships.

This advisory highlights significant risks for sports organizations engaging in cryptocurrency sponsorships without proper regulatory oversight, emphasizing the need for due diligence in partner selection.

As noted, both BingX and OKX lack FCA authorization despite their partnerships with top football teams, underscoring the importance of compliance in the evolving crypto landscape.
